Abstract
Abstract This case is a unique co‐presentation of mixed uterine and ovarian teratoma in a middle‐aged female Labrador dog with chief complaint of purulent vaginal discharge. On ultrasonographic examination, a large anechoic mass with several echogenic flakes in uterine lumen and cystic cavitation of endometrial surface was identified without any metastasis on radiography. After 2‐week medicinal therapy, ovariohysterectomy of dog was done and pyometra with large greyish white globoid soft fibroid mass (8.5 × 9.5 cm) on anterior border of right uterine horn formed remarkable findings. The histopathological analysis revealed stratified squamous metaplasia of endometrial epithelium with strong epidermal reaction pattern, in addition to, indistinct areas of degenerated hair follicle(s) and melanin deposits, areas of irregular, aggressive neuro‐fibromatous stroma, amidst muscular stroma turned fibrous and adipose connective tissues component. The dog recovered uneventfully. Therefore, we report rare case of mixed uterine and ovarian teratoma along with cystic endometrial hyperplasia‒pyometra complex in dog.
